  1. Richard Ngarava – 10 overs – 96 – 1

Pretty much like the case of Peter Chase, the teenaged left-arm pacer Richard Ngarava of Zimbabwe too had the bear the brunt of the brutalities of ODI cricket into the initial days of his ODI career.

In an ODI against Scotland in Edinburg in June, the 19-year old was hammered for 96 in his spell of 10 overs, as the hosts took a liking for the rookie. Termed as a talent to watch out for in the Zimbabwean cricket circles, Ngarava can surely take this outing as a lesson and improve in the near future.
